First, some clarity is essential. “Rkpx3” is not a brand name like Pioneer, Sony, or Kenwood. It’s not even a specific product model. Instead, Rkpx3 (often capitalized as RKPX3) refers to a system-on-a-chip manufactured by the Chinese semiconductor company Rockchip. Specifically, it points to the Rockchip PX3 or a closely related cousin like the RK3188—a quad-core Cortex-A9 processor clocked at up to 1.6GHz paired with a Mali-400 GPU.
